/* strtoull( const char *, char * *, int )
|
|
|
|
This file is part of the Public Domain C Library (PDCLib).
|
|
Permission is granted to use, modify, and / or redistribute at will.
|
|
*/
|
|
|
|
#include <limits.h>
|
|
#include <stdlib.h>
|
|
|
|
#ifndef REGTEST
|
|
|
|
#include <stdint.h>
|
|
|
|
unsigned long long int strtoull( const char * s, char ** endptr, int base )
|
|
{
|
|
unsigned long long int rc;
|
|
char sign = '+';
|
|
const char * p = _PDCLIB_strtox_prelim( s, &sign, &base );
|
|
if ( base < 2 || base > 36 ) return 0;
|
|
rc = _PDCLIB_strtox_main( &p, (unsigned)base, (uintmax_t)ULLONG_MAX, (uintmax_t)( ULLONG_MAX / base ), (int)( ULLONG_MAX % base ), &sign );
|
|
if ( endptr != NULL ) *endptr = ( p != NULL ) ? (char *) p : (char *) s;
|
|
return ( sign == '+' ) ? rc : -rc;
|
|
}
|
|
|
|
#endif
